Role: AEM Forms Developer Duration: 6 months with potential for extension Location: **Austin is preferred, but we will consider fully remote as well**
Opportunity Client Reporting Technology (CRT) organization has an opportunity for an experienced Adobe Experience Manager Developer to help speed our modernization efforts for regulatory forms for our clients. This developer will be focused on building Adaptive Web Form content within the AEM forms tool as well as work with the existing team to enhance pipeline when needed. This developer should also be familiar with AI technologies such as GitHub Copilot to help speed delivery as much as possible.
Required Qualifications
3- 5 years of experience working within the on-prem version of Adobe Experience Manager (AEM) toolset. Preferred to have experience with AEM forms and building of Adaptive Web Forms using Core components in a headless setup.
Handle end-to-end form lifecycle (UI --> submission --> backend --> DOR )
Experience in utilizing core AEM concepts to build and define APIs for form submissions
Preferable Experience with Automated Testing of Adaptive forms
Professional level front end skillsets such as HTML, JSP, NPM webpack build
Knowledge on code upgrade and Code promotion including core component upgrades and deployments through package manager
Ability to troubleshoot issues related to SAML, oSGI bundles
Experience in using AEM Dispatcher in a form's environment
Demonstrated exposure to, or hands-on experience with, GenAI coding assistants used across day-to-day engineering workflows in the SDLC—implementation, refactoring, unit testing, regression support, code reviews, scripting/automation, troubleshooting, and documentation—while applying engineering judgment and validation. Practical familiarity with tools such as GitHub Copilot or Claude Code is expected
Working knowledge of agentic workflows, spec-driven development (translating low-level design artifacts such as class structures, API contracts, and data models into structured specs that guide AI-assisted implementation), and custom instructions and prompt engineering, with the ability to establish team-level practices for effective AI-assisted development.
Experience with CI/CD tools like Bitbucket/Bamboo/Jenkin/GitHub etc.
Preferred Qualifications
Experience with headless content delivery
Experience coding in Angular, Typescript, Javascript, HTML, CSS, bootstrap, backbone ReactJS (sophisticated capabilities required for front end focused roles)
Experience working with web servers Jboss, weblogic, IIS, Apache
Knowledge of Web Content Management Systems
